    So we all know the nvidia issues with the m1330's by now. I got my m1330 in August, 2008 and am currently on my third motherboard, and it's crapping out again. The last time it was replaced was December, 2009. Seems like they're good for about six months. In December I had to resort to a corporate bomb-type e-mail to get any attention. I wanted them to give me a new XPS 13 but they would only replace the motherboard AGAIN. They assured me though that the motherboard was revised and would never fail again. LIES!

    So now my computer is cranking at 217* F rendering a 480p Hulu video and the screen is starting to flicker (it idles at 185* F). I'm about to get real ugly with Dell demanding a replacement, but I'm noticing they don't offer anything similar to this laptop right now. I LOVE this computer (shape, size, style, weight) but can't keep going replacing the mobo every six months! Has anyone gotten a replacement out of Dell recently for one of these? What do you think they'd give me? I still have 422 days of bumper to bumper warranty. Thanks in advance!
